Output c804f77ab15fc33116b4a829a08e010def87c95d124ca3013a47a384f24f0c85:0

value
84666109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75ada92e6c0f37a2ea46162495d3b51bdae1777f OP_EQUALVERIFY OP_CHECKSIG
address
1BjE6cXfqskwDW4omy6CV3Lrx5ba256K8v
transaction
c804f77ab15fc33116b4a829a08e010def87c95d124ca3013a47a384f24f0c85